Nature and bug enthusiasts, gardeners and glass collectors will be snatching up this coin featuring a Murano glass monarch caterpillar. Caterpillars are an essential part of the natural world. Without them, there can be no butterflies; and without milkweed plants, there can be no monarchs. They are the only plants monarch larvae feed upon. This coins reverse design is punctuated by a vivid Murano glass monarch caterpillar that was handcrafted by master glassmakers Bernardino and Giorgio Vio, in Murano, Italy; its yellow, black and white stripes are the tell-tale sign it is a monarch larva. The glass monarch caterpillar is poised on the leaf of a swamp milkweed plant designed by Canadian artist Maurice Gervais that has been selectively coloured to showcase the plants long leaves, and its clusters of pink flowers to best effect. HIGHLY COLLECTIBLE: this coin is the 3rd and final issue to complete the Little Creatures Series (snail, beetle, monarch caterpillar), and our 10th coin to feature Murano glass, a centuries-old craft that is world-renowned for its vibrant, fluid colours. Leaf Beetle The family Chrysomelidae, commonly known as leaf beetles, includes over 37,000 (and probably at least 50,000) species in more than 2,500 genera, making it one of the largest and most commonly encountered of all beetle families. Numerous subfamilies are recognized, but only some of them are listed below and the precise taxonomy and systematics are likely to change with ongoing research. Leaf beetles are partially recognizable by their tarsal formula, which appears to be 4-4-4, but is actually 5-5-5 as the 4th tarsal segment is very small and hidden by the 3rd. As with many taxa, there is no single character that defines the Chrysomelidae; instead it is delineated by a set of characters. Some lineages are only distinguished with difficulty from longhorn beetles (family Cerambycidae), namely by the antennae not arising from frontal tubercles. Adult and larval leaf beetles feed on all sorts of plant tissue, and all species are fully herbivorous. Many are serious pests of cultivated plants, for example the Colorado potato beetle (Leptinotarsa decemlineata), the asparagus beetle (Crioceris asparagi), the cereal leaf beetle (Oulema melanopus), and various flea beetles, and a few act as vectors of plant diseases. Others are beneficial due to their use in biocontrol of invasive weeds. Some Chrysomelidae are conspicuously colored, typically in glossy yellow to red or metallic blue-green hues, and some (especially Cassidinae) have spectacularly bizarre shapes. Selective black rhodium plating sets the tone for the night scene on the reverse, where moonlight suddenly reveals the bats shadowy presence! From the edge of the Arctic tundra to the Great Lakes, the little brown bat (Myotis lucifugus) owns the night by using echolocation to locate its insect prey. Our Nocturnal by Nature series continues its exploration of a nocturnal Canada, using selective black rhodium plating to set the tone for a night-time encounter with the diminutive flying mammal. Second coin in a series featuring surprise encounters with some of Canadas nocturnal wildlife. Selective black rhodium plating sets the tone for the night scene on the reverse, where moonlight suddenly reveals the bats shadowy presence. Represents a unique twist on traditional wildlife portraits, thanks to outstanding mix of engraving, selective plating and finishes that skilfully enhance each and every element. Surrounded by rhodium plating, the coins surface mimics the effect of natural lightwhether its the intense shine of a full moon, or moonlight spilling across the back of the matte silhouette! The reverse design by Canadian artist Calder Moore brings the viewer face-to-face with the little brown bat. Rhodium plating represents the dark night sky that fills most of the fieldsave for the full moon that is faithfully engraved at the centre. The enhanced shine of the coins silver surface mimics the effect of lunar luminosity in this nocturnal setting, where a little brown bat suddenly makes its presence known overhead. The rhodium-plated hunter appears like a shadowy figure in the night thanks to a matte finish. And with moonlight spilling down across its back and outstretched wings, the bats engraved features are faintly visible.
